The Abstergo Industries Tokyo facility was a complex belonging to Abstergo Industries located in Tokyo, Japan. It notably housed research on transplanting Isu technology into humans,[1] with the goal of creating advanced technologies and forcibly augmenting human subjects into super soldiers.[2]

At some point after 02 November 2019,[note 1] Juhani Otso Berg was brought to the facility, having been left paraplegic by the actions of Assassin Layla Hassan. The experiments allowed him to survive the ordeal and regain use of his legs.[3]

Around 2020, a report detailing the experiments carried out on non-voluntary subjects carried out in the laboratory was intercepted by Hassan. The report also mentioned extensive analysis of Isu artifacts. The Assassins decided to gather a team and infiltrate the facility, in order to investigate the experiments and stop them, aided by information given to them by Doctor Kazui.[1]

The Templars also studied the powers of one of the Staves of Eden,[2] being on the verge of locating it when the Assassin team intervened and destroyed the DNA data they had being using to do so.[4] The Assassins also managed to exfiltrate Dr. Kazui,[5] before being ambushed by Otso Berg using an incendiary grenade.[3] The Assassins destroyed Abstergo Tokyo's archives, recovered files on other subjects Abstergo sought to kidnap, ended their research on Isu artifacts, and got rid of Otso Berg.[6]
